Output 24a3d886304ad702824039d6e87ab4b0b869e8835ed3061da55a9ead73b9e92b:1

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8d993b3885e8ec83ed9099cb3a877cf2b5e5f2 OP_EQUAL
address
35qsxciJcxJepcvu764ZEMPfGwKZHG3QVv
transaction
24a3d886304ad702824039d6e87ab4b0b869e8835ed3061da55a9ead73b9e92b
confirmations
245727
spent
true